Job description

We're seeking Child and Youth Workers (CYW/CYW) in the Windsor Essex region for flexible casual and part-time opportunities with our partnering community agencies, offering an hourly rate of $21 to $23.This role is ideal for experienced youth workers who can serve as positive role models, maintain professionalism in documentation, and support children and youth in residential or community programs.

Candidates must have a Child and Youth Worker diploma or degree and direct experience working in Child & Youth residential programming, assessments, behavioural support, and crisis intervention.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provide trauma-informed, strengths-based support to children and youth in residential or community-based settings.
  • Act as a positive role model with strong social skills, professionalism, and emotional intelligence.
  • Support youth with routines, independent living skills, behavioural regulation, and program goals.
  • Assist with crisis prevention, de-escalation, and interventions using approved techniques (e.g., UMAB or equivalent).
  • Complete clear, timely documentation, shift logs, assessments, and incident reports.
  • Contribute to a safe, culturally responsive, and inclusive environment.
  • Work collaboratively with teams and maintain flexibility for various shifts, including weekends and statutory holidays.
Qualifications & Requirements
  • Mandatory: Child and Youth Worker diploma or degree (CYW/CYC) or a related diploma/degree (BA, BSW, DSW).
  • Minimum 1 year experience supporting children and youth in residential, group home, treatment, or community programs.
  • Familiarity with youth mental health, developmental and learning disabilities, trauma-informed care, and harm reduction.
  • Valid CPR/First Aid, UMAB (Understanding & Managing Aggressive Behaviour) or equivalent crisis intervention certification.
  • Valid Ontario Drivers License with 1M liability insurance is an asset.
  • Recent Vulnerable Sector Check (within 6 months).
  • Up-to-date immunizations and health assessment.
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ills, especially in documentation and report writing.
  • Bilingual French/English is an asset.
  • Flexibility to work casual, part-time, evening, weekend, or statutory holiday shifts.
Compensation

$21 -$23 per hour, based on education, experience, and certifications.
